Abstract
In this paper, we continue to study the sharing value problems for higher order derivatives of meromorphic functions with its linear difference and -difference operators. Some of our results generalize and improve the results of Meng--Liu (J. Appl. Math. and Informatics, 37(2019), 133--148) to a large extent.
